计算机硬件对操作系统影响的分析:硬件与软件如何配合

时间:2025-12-06 分类:操作系统

计算机硬件和操作系统之间的关系犹如两位密不可分的舞者,共同演绎出一场协调而优雅的舞蹈。硬件是计算机系统的基础,其性能和功能直接影响操作系统的效率和稳定性。而操作系统则是利用这些硬件资源的桥梁,帮助用户和计算机之间进行有效的沟通。了解二者之间的相互作用,对于提升计算机性能和用户体验至关重要。本文将深入分析计算机硬件对操作系统的影响,并探讨硬件与软件如何更加高效地配合。

计算机硬件对操作系统影响的分析:硬件与软件如何配合

计算机硬件的构成,包括中央处理器(CPU)、内存、存储设备和输入输出设备等,都会对操作系统的运行产生深远影响。以CPU为例,不同架构和性能的处理器在执行任务时的效率差异,能直接影响操作系统的响应速度和多任务处理能力。在多核处理器的环境下,操作系统必须具备合理的线程调度机制,以充分利用硬件的并行处理能力,提升整体性能。

内存的大小和速度也显著影响操作系统的整体表现。充足且快速的内存可以使操作系统在执行时更为流畅,减少页面交换的频率,从而提高应用程序的运行效率。在现代计算机中,虚拟内存技术的引入,允许操作系统通过管理物理内存和硬盘的配合,为应用程序提供更大的内存空间。

存储设备的发展同样不容忽视,固态硬盘(SSD)的普及使得数据读取和写入的速度大幅提高。操作系统在进行文件系统管理和数据访问时,享受到了SSD带来的高性能,显著缩短了开机时间和应用软件加载时间。对于需要频繁读写大数据量的应用程序,快速的存储设备变得尤为重要。

输入输出设备的变化也在一定程度上影响着操作系统与用户的交互方式。现代计算机系统中,各种外设的驱动程序和操作系统的兼容性,决定了用户体验的流畅性。操作系统需要不断更新和优化,确保能够支持新型硬件的功能,提升整体的操作体验。

可以明确的是,硬件与操作系统的紧密结合,为实现计算机的高效运作提供了可能性。通过不断优化硬件设计和操作系统架构,二者能够更好地发挥各自的优势,从而推动整个计算机领域的发展。每一次技术的进步,都离不开硬件与软件的携手并进,这一合作将继续在未来的科技进程中扮演重要角色。